Position SummaryThe OB Nurse Navigator – Labor & Delivery RN serves as a clinical liaison for obstetrical patients and their families throughout the labor, delivery, and postpartum process. This role focuses on patient education, care coordination, and support to ensure a safe, informed, and positive birthing experience.
Responsibilities- Serve as the primary clinical liaison for obstetrical patients and their families throughout the labor and delivery process
- Educate patients and families on labor, delivery, postpartum care, and hospital policies to promote a positive birthing experience
- Coordinate and support individualized care plans in collaboration with obstetricians, midwives, anesthesiology, and nursing staff
